Understanding Fabric Types
Picking the right fabric for premium bedding can markedly enhance the standard of sleep and overall bedroom aesthetic. Various fabric types offer unique benefits and characteristics. Cotton is a popular choice due to its breathability and softness, making it perfect for year-round use. Linen, known for its durability and moisture-wicking properties, provides a laid-back, textured feel. Tencel, derived from eucalyptus trees, is sustainable and boasts a silky touch, excellent for sensitive skin. Satin and silk provide a luxurious sheen and smooth texture but require more delicate care. Picking the right fabric ultimately relies on personal preferences, climate, and desired maintenance level, laying the foundation for a comfortable and stylish bedroom retreat.
Thread Count Significance
Thread count acts as a vital measure of fabric quality in premium bedding, influencing both comfort and durability. Typically, a higher thread count suggests a tighter, softer fabric, improving the overall sleeping experience. Bedding with a thread count between 300 and 600 is often viewed as ideal, striking a balance between luxury and breathability. However, it is essential to examine the type of fibers used; natural fibers like cotton or linen tend to yield better results than synthetic alternatives. Moreover, thread count should not be the sole factor; the weave and finish also contribute to the fabric's feel and longevity. Choosing premium bed linen requires examining these elements together to ensure a peaceful and stylish sleep environment.

Tips for Preserving Your Bed Linen's Lifespan
To ensure bed linen stays in pristine condition over the years, appropriate maintenance is crucial. Regular washing is essential; it is recommended to wash bed linens every seven to fourteen days, using cold or lukewarm water and a soft detergent. Refrain from using bleach, as it can weaken fibers and modify colors.
Drying bed linen ought to be done on a low heat setting to avoid shrinkage and damage. When possible, air drying is preferable, as sunlight works to eliminate bacteria and refreshes fabrics naturally.
Steam-pressing bed linens at a low temperature can improve their appearance, but this step is optional. Furthermore, storing linens in a dry, cool location stops mildew and maintains freshness.
Lastly, rotating linens can assist in distribute damage, guaranteeing that each set remains durable longer. By implementing these maintenance suggestions, one can experience comfortable and fashionable bed linen for years to come.

Eco-Friendly Bedding Options Available
With consumers placing greater emphasis on environmental sustainability, a increasing selection of high-quality bedding options has become available online. Brands are now featuring bedding manufactured with organic materials like cotton, linen, and bamboo, confirming that products are not only luxurious but also eco-friendly. Sustainable bedding often features certifications such as GOTS (Global Organic Textile Standard) or OEKO-TEX, ensuring customers that their purchases are free from harmful chemicals.
Online retailers dedicated to green bedding offer a array of designs and colors to match different tastes. Buyers can discover products from trusted brands focused on ethical practices, including fair labor and sustainable sourcing. This evolution toward sustainability in bedding reflects a wider dedication to decreasing environmental impact while boosting home comfort and style.

Fabric Selection by Season
Picking the right fabric for bed linen is crucial for attaining seasonal comfort and style. In spring and summer, light materials such as cotton and linen are recommended, providing breathability and a clean feel. These fabrics help manage temperature, ensuring coolness during warmer months. Conversely, as autumn and winter come, heavier options like flannel and brushed cotton become ideal. These fabrics offer warmth and coziness, perfect for cooler nights. Additionally, incorporating textures like velvet or jersey can boost comfort during colder seasons. By selecting appropriate fabrics, individuals can not only enjoy a comfortable sleep experience but also elevate their bedroom aesthetic, reflecting the changing moods and colors of each season.
